Right now I am at the investor approval stage. Bank of America countered and we accepted. There is only one lien and there is no PMI. How long does it normally take to hear back from the investor these days? It has been 2 weeks since we accepted the offer. Do they always give verbals first or am I just waiting on a written counter or approval?

Since June 19th. The negotiator at BofA is trying to contact investor daily and getting no updates
it really depends on the investor and if you are lucky enough to get on the top of someones stack of files.. could be a week could be 2 months.. I am almost at 2 months and still nowhere..
I would say avg 10 days, but it could be much sooner or longer .. you never really know..

Interesting update today..
My Mortgage guy decided to contact the investor directly. The investor informed him they have sent the file back to the bank yesterday, and that it took so long because it was incomplete when BofA submitted it to the investor. He told us BofA should be contacting us today or tomorrow.
Here's the interesting part, he made no implication on an approval just stayed very general and didnt hint either way. Not sure if this is good since the BPO most likely is expired at this point and some of the docs reflected a closing date of today.
Really hoping none of these issues are going to cause the whole process to be restarted again!
